Summary
This is a public statement issued by the Jersey Financial Services Commission naming Mr Andrew Crawford Norman Fleming and describing regulatory directions issued against him following his criminal conviction for supplying the Commission with false and misleading information. It is an individual enforcement notice rather than a rule of general application, but it creates binding restrictions on Mr Fleming and imposes a duty on financial services businesses not to employ or engage him.
- Background: Mr Fleming was convicted on 19 June 2015 by Jersey's Royal Court of supplying false and misleading information to the Commission, contrary to Article 28(1) of the Financial Services (Jersey) Law 1998, and was sentenced to 12 months imprisonment.
- Directions issued: Under Article 23(1) of the FS(J)L, the Commission has directed that Mr Fleming may not perform any function for, be employed by, or hold any position in any business licensed to conduct financial services business in Jersey.
- Duration: The directions remain in force unless and until Mr Fleming successfully applies under Article 23(6) for a variance or withdrawal; he has also received equivalent directions under the Banking Business (Jersey) Law 1991, the Collective Investment Funds (Jersey) Law 1988, and the Insurance Business (Jersey) Law 1996.
- Offences created: Mr Fleming commits an offence under Article 23(15) if he fails to comply with the directions; any person who knowingly allows him to perform a function, take employment, or hold a position in contravention of the directions commits an offence under Article 23(15A).
Licensed financial services businesses in Jersey should be aware of these restrictions to avoid inadvertently allowing Mr Fleming to work in or hold a position within a regulated business, as doing so knowingly is itself a criminal offence.
Key obligations
- Mr Fleming must not perform any function for, engage in employment by, or hold any position in any business licensed to conduct financial services business in Jersey, or he commits an offence under Article 23(15) of the FS(J)L.
- Any person or business must not knowingly allow Mr Fleming to perform a function, engage in employment, or hold a position in contravention of the directions, or they commit an offence under Article 23(15A) of the FS(J)L.
